US-China AI Competition Intensifies Across Technology, Standards, and Governance
The competition between the United States and China in the field of artificial intelligence (AI) is intensifying, with both nations vying for dominance in technology ecosystems, standards, and global governance. The U.S. maintains a lead in early AI development, but China's growing power and strategic initiatives, such as the World AI Cooperation Organization (WAICO), aim to reshape global AI standards and governance. This rivalry is evident in contrasting approaches: the U.S. focuses on tight control over core technologies, while China promotes open-source collaboration and data sharing. These efforts reflect broader geopolitical strategies as both countries seek to expand their influence in the AI domain.
